Located in quiet South Ayrshire, the Dundonald Castle was once the historic home of King Robert II of Scotland.
The 14th-century hilltop fortress site is looked after daily by Dundonald Castle SCIO's friends, who also manage the site's visitor center.
Visitors can see the barrel-vaulted ceilings, enjoy the spectacular coastal scenery, and experience the history of the past 2,000 years from the ruins.
